Sunday's Pa. roundup: Bonner-Prendergast boys' basketball clips West Catholic behind Isaiah Wong's heroics

Highlighting Sunday's top basketball action in Southeastern Pennsylvania.

Isaiah Wong's mid-range bank shot with seven seconds left Sunday lifted the Bonner-Prendergast boys' basketball team over West Catholic, 68-67, in a Catholic League game. Wong finished with a game-high 20 points, while teammate Tyriq Ingraham chipped in 16 points.

Harrison Klevan finished with 25 points as Lower Merion upended Neshaminy, 73-64, in the Kobe Bryant Classic. Steve Payne chipped in with 19 points for the Aces. Chris Arcidiacono scored a game-high 29 points for the Redskins.

Andrew Funk recorded 25 points in Archbishop Wood's 80-68 triumph over Cardinal O'Hara. Tyree Pickron added 17 points for the Vikings.

Eric Esposito and Patrick Robinson each scored 26 points in Conwell-Egan's 86-81 triumph over Bishop McDevitt.

Girls' Basketball

Mo'ne Davis scored a game-high 21 points and was named MVP of the game as the Springside Chestnut Hill topped Lower Merion, 49-45, in the Kobe Bryant Classic. Caroline Clark and Destiny Rogers added 12 and 11 points, respectively, for the Blue Devils.

Hoops for Hope Classic

Danielle MCurdy led all scorers with 19 points as Archbishop Ryan knocked off York Catholic, 62-51. Monee Moore and Taliyah Rahman scored 10 points apiece as the Ragdolls improved to 17-0 on the season.

Haley Meinel recorded 17 points as Central Bucks South defeated St. Basil, 36-29. Alexa Brodie contributed 10 points for the Titans.
